Abstract

Spondyloarthropathies are one of the most frequent causes of anterior uveitis. Uveitis associated with spondyloarthropathies fall within the group of uveitis related to the histocompatibility antigen HLA-B27. To present a review of uveitis associated with seronegative spondyloarthropathies (ankylosing spondylitis, psoriatic arthropathy, reactive arthritis or Reiter's syndrome and inflammatory bowel disease), as well as ocular involvement in the context of adult rheumatoid arthritis and arthritis Juvenile idiopathic. Ocular manifestations, including episcleritis, scleritis, peripheral ulcerative keratitis, and dry eye disease, can be found in up to 39% of rheumatoid arthritis patients. Recurrent unilateral acute anterior uveitis is the most frequent in spondyloarthropathies, and can be the initiation of a previously undiagnosed spondyloarthropathy.
